What is the model number for your hub? The only hubs on 29.8 are the SmartThings v2 (2015) and v3 (2018) hubs. Other hubs should be on different versions of the firmware.

The following support page would list the firmware versions for each hub…

But if your zigbee State is not detected, you should contact ST support and let them look at your hub.
